> does the JVM not optimize for this case in the fast-path? 

Hi Ryan, from the benchmark results 
[here|https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-6884?focusedCommentId=12900087&page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els%3Acomment-tabpanel#action_12900087],
 it does not seem JVM optimized this.  I think JVM cannot do anything in 
general since parameter evaluation may have side-effect.  It is hard for the 
JVM to determine whether it is safe to skip those instructions.

> Each LOG.debug("...") should be executed only if LOG.isDebugEnabled() is 
> true, in some cases it's expensive to construct the string that is being 
> printed to log. It's much easier to always use LOG.isDebugEnabled() because 
> it's easier to check (rather than in each case reason wheather it's 
> neccessary or not).
